THE THEORY OF DESCRIPTIVE TEXT
1. Social Function : To describe a patricular person, place, or thing (mendeskripsikan seseorang, tempat, atau barang).
2. Generic Structure :
Ø Identification : identifies the phenomenon to be describe (identifikasi hal / seorang yang akan dideskripsikan).
Ø Description : describes parts, qualities, characteristic (berisi tentang penjelasan / penggambaran tentang hal atau seseorang dengan menyebutkan beberapa sifatnya).
Ø Timeless Present tense
3. Lexicogrammatical Features :
o Tenses → Present tense Verbal sentences : Nominal sentences
o Focusing on a particular subject

THE AMAZING OF TAJ MAHAL IN INDIA
Taj Mahal is regarded as one of the eight wonders of the world. It was built by a Muslim Emperor Shah Jahan in the memory of his dear wife at Agra.
Taj Mahal is a Mausoleum that houses the grave of queen Mumtaz Mahal. The mausoleum is a part of a vast complex comprising of a main gateway, an elaborate garden, a mosque (to the left), a guest house (to the right), and several other palatial buildings. The Taj is at the farthest end of this complex, with the river Jamuna behind it.
The Taj stands on a raised, square platform (186 x 186 feet) with its four corners truncated, forming an unequal octagon. The architectural design uses the interlocking arabesque concept, in which each element stands on its own and perfectly integrates with the main structure. It uses the principles of self-replicating geometry and a symmetry of architectural elements.
Its central dome is fifty-eight feet in diameter and rises to a height of 213 feet. It is flanked by four subsidiary domed chambers. The four graceful, slender minarets are 162.5 feet each. The central domed chamber and four adjoining chambers include many walls and panels of Islamic decoration.
Taj Mahal is built entirely of white marble. Its stunning architectural beauty is beyond adequate description, particularly at dawn and sunset. The Taj seems to glow in the light of the full moon. On a foggy morning, the visitors experience the Taj as if suspended when viewed from across the Jamuna river.
